dd备份恢复树莓派sd

缘起树莓派真的是费sd卡,说白了使用sd卡基本上就是个玩具,可靠性非常的差,而我这个树莓派是7*24小时不间断运行的,已经坏了2张卡了o( ̄︶ ̄)o于是定期备份系统的习惯我就养成了,之前直接使用dd备份系统,镜像文件很大,比如sd卡32G,使用了10G,备份出来就是32G这么大。因此最近在折腾增加一个压缩过程,这样存储以及备份传输就会快点。折腾过程注意:dd操作非常的危险,一定要注意从哪里dd到哪里,搞错了数据可就没了,一定要想好后再按回车备份系统并压缩备份系统sd卡,非常的简单,在dd命令配合 阅读全部

群晖ssh免密登录

缘起前段时间搞的黑裙已经稳定运行了2个月没有任何的问题,因此在ubuntu nas上的常用数据就可以定期备份到黑裙上了。开始时手工rsync同步过去,每次输密码上去就可以了,但是现在稳定后需要定期自动同步,输密码就不行了。因此折腾了群晖的ssh免密登录。折腾过程准备秘钥ssh免密登录需要再客户端(这里的客户端指的ubuntu nas)和服务端都安装ssh且生成秘钥,可以使用如下命令就可以生成秘钥了,一路回车即可。ssh-keygen -t rsa -b 2 阅读全部

openwrt 127.0.0.1地址不能访问问题解决

缘起最近这段时间在折腾openwrt软路由,用来做一些流量的控制,基于dns的广告过滤这些事情。但是随着软件包以及服务的增多,最近非常的不稳定,经常出现软路由openwrt自己不能上网的情况。主要表现为:1、ping 127.0.0.1 可以通2、运行在127.0.0.1上的所有服务都不能正常,包括dns解析服务、nginx等3、开机重启时是好的,但是经过一段时间运行就挂掉折腾过程经过各种尝试以及搜索资料,都没有找到明确的问题原因,网上127.0.0.1不能访问的,大多说的是防火墙、lo接口的问 阅读全部

kvm增加虚拟磁盘大小

缘起最近用libvirt建了一个专门运行pi-hole的kvm虚拟机,由于目的非常明确,安装了debian系统,同时只分配了2G的存储空间。经过一段时间的运行,各种日志、软件的添加,系统分区已经空间不足了,因此需要动态扩容一下。折腾过程拓展磁盘空间1、关闭虚拟机(这里debian是我虚拟机的名称)virsh shutdown debian2、备份老的虚拟磁盘文件(一定要备份,防止意外)3、拓展虚拟磁盘空间# 查看磁盘信息 sudo qemu-img& 阅读全部

ubuntu获取LTS版本内核更新

缘起家里的nas宿主机用的ubuntu server 18.04,内核一直是比较老的4.15,最近偶然间看新闻发现18.04.4已经支持了最新的5.x内核,于是搜寻一番也升级下。折腾过程过程非常的简单,开启ubuntu对LTS支持的hwe即可,关于hwe,其实就相当于对LTS长期支持版本的小升级啦,跟随18.94.x最后这个小版本号升级,现在18.0.4已经是5.3内核啦。安装方法非常的简单,如下1、桌面版安装sudo apt install --install-r 阅读全部

电脑端scrcpy控制Android手机

缘起有一个非常老的号码,放在备用机里边,基本处于挂机状态,使用程序自动发送电话、短信记录到邮箱。但是最近备用机屏幕磕了一下,不能正常触摸了,导致基本删不可用了,因此需要捣鼓一个可以通过电脑端控制手机操作的软件(注:像xx手机助手这种就别说了)。折腾过程在chrome浏览器的扩展里找到了类似的软件(syncxx),但是居然是收费的,我想不通这个Android官方开发工具Android studio里都有类似实现的功能,居然还收费,那果断放弃了。经过一番折腾,发现一个小巧好用的工具scrcpy,开源 阅读全部

黑群晖硬盘休眠问题解决

阅读全部

树莓派安装pi-hole进行广告过滤

缘起之前树莓派3B一直在角落里作为NAS来使用,包括smb共享,transsim 下载等等用途,但是这段时间基于j3455的nas替代了树莓派的这些功能,树莓派就降级为一个linux系统了,不包含任何的个人数据,只作为一个自动化执行工具来用,跑跑定时的小任务就好了。前段时间发现了一个有趣的小软件,叫做pi-hole,能够将树莓派变身为一个dns服务器,可以像abp类似的过滤掉一些广告网址(dns劫持实现)。而目前树莓派的职责,不包含任何的个人数据,用来做这些事情就比较随意了,于是就有了这一波折腾 阅读全部

undefined symbol: EVP_CIPHER_CTX_cleanup错误解决

解决方法如下:用vi打开文件:vi /usr/lib/python2.7/site-packages/出错的openssl位置/crypto/openssl.py跳转到52行(ss2.8.2版本,其他版本搜索一下cleanup)进入编辑模式将第52行libcrypto.EVP_CIPHER_CTX_cleanup.argtypes = (c_void_p,)改为libcrypto.EVP_CIPHER_CTX_reset.argtypes = (c_void_p,)再次搜索cleanup(全文件 阅读全部

centos yum update更新异常终止修复

缘起有一个限制的腾讯云的vps,放在那做了个简单的ip监测,cpu占用很高。前几天centos 7.7 release了,yun update一下几百个包需要更新,由于在高铁上连上去yum update的,这下问题来了o( ̄︶ ̄)oupdate了一半,连接断开了,再次连上去yum update就一直报重复包以及依赖解决不了的问题。错误:软件包:glibc-common-2.17-260.el7_6.6.x86_64 (@updates)    & 阅读全部